Sevierville, nestled at the gateway to the Great Smoky Mountains, isn’t just a scenic town - it’s a place where Americana and film quietly meet. While it may not have the blockbuster resume of LA or NYC, Sevierville’s charm has made it a sought-after filming location for country music videos, indie films, and classic Americana documentaries.

What Makes Sevierville a Hidden Filming Gem?

This small town offers big-screen landscapes. Rolling hills, vintage diners, rustic barns, and winding roads through the misty mountains give filmmakers a natural set. Plus, it’s the hometown of Dolly Parton - her influence brings a rich blend of music, history, and showbiz flair.

Spots to Discover on a Movie Tour:

  • Dolly Parton's Childhood Home – a must-see for fans and a recurring backdrop in country music media
  • Great Smoky Mountains National Park – featured in numerous documentaries and travel features
  • Historic Downtown Sevierville – charming streets used in indie and period films
  • Local farms and backroads – often featured in music videos and lifestyle films
